【十进制算法中】在计算机科学和数学运算中,十进制算法是一种基于数字“0-9”进行计算的方法。它广泛应用于日常计算、编程语言处理以及数据存储等领域。十进制算法的核心在于对数位的识别与操作,包括加法、减法、乘法和除法等基本运算。
为了更清晰地理解十进制算法的基本原理和应用,以下是对十进制算法的总结,并结合表格形式展示其主要特点和应用场景。
十进制算法总结
十进制算法是以10为基数的计数系统,每一位上的数值代表的是10的幂次方。例如,数字“345”表示3×10² + 4×10¹ + 5×10⁰。这种算法在人类日常生活中最为常见,也常用于计算机中的浮点数运算和数据处理。
十进制算法的关键点包括:
- 进位机制:当某一位的数值超过9时,需要向高位进位。
- 借位机制:在减法过程中,若当前位不够减,则需从高位借位。
- 位权计算:每一位的值由其所在位置决定,即10的幂次方。
- 精度控制:在涉及小数时,需注意有效数字的保留与舍入。
十进制算法特点与应用场景对比表
特点 | 描述 | 应用场景 |
基数为10 | 每个位置上的数字只能是0-9 | 日常计算、金融计算 |
进位规则 | 每满10进1 | 加法运算、自动计数系统 |
借位规则 | 不足时向高位借1 | 减法运算、财务结算 |
位权计算 | 每位的权重为10的幂次 | 数据编码、数值转换 |
精度控制 | 小数部分需处理有效位 | 科学计算、工程设计 |
易于理解 | 人类最熟悉的计数方式 | 教育、基础编程 |
结语
十进制算法作为最基本的数值计算方式,不仅在数学教育中占据重要地位,也在实际应用中发挥着不可替代的作用。尽管现代计算机更多使用二进制算法,但十进制算法仍然在许多领域中被广泛应用,尤其是在需要人机交互或精确表达数值的场合。掌握十进制算法的基本原理,有助于更好地理解其他进制系统的运作方式。